The drama film A Biltmore Christmas, starring Bethany Joy Lenz, Kristoffer Polaha, Robert Picardo, etc., directed by John Putch, was released on November 26, 2023 in Estados Unidos. It tells the story of It follows Lucy as she's hired to write the script for a remake of a holiday movie. She joins a tour of the grounds and when she knocks an hourglass over, she finds herself transported back in time to 1946. This is a Drama, Pantasya, Romansa film with a runtime of 84 minutes and its worldwide box office is not listed in the available detail data. It has received a rating of 7.6/10 from 6,876 viewers.

When I learned that two of my favorite Hallmark stars were paired up in a time travel story, I had high expectations. This wonderful movie exceeded those expectations. Bethany Joy Lenz is always great, but she just glows as Lucy Hardgrove, a screenwriter working on a remake of a beloved 1940s movie. Kristoffer Polaha plays Jack Huston, one of the stars of that old movie which, in this movie, is shown in black and white for authenticity. Polaha probably has one of the smoothest sounding voices in the world and he's very effective as a 1940s movie star. This movie was a lot of fun. There's a magic hourglass, a mysterious hotel worker, feuding cast members, a sweet enthusiastic fan, a writer/director who drove away the love of his life, elaborate period costumes, old cars, a sweet rendition of Jingle Bells, lots of eggnog, a surprise cameo, a Jimmy Stewart impersonation, lines about TCM and His Girl Friday, and a character who says her name is Sandra Bullock. Hallmark movies are (unfairly) criticized for being "all the same" and "predictable", but I honestly had no idea how the movie was going to play out. That's a tribute to the writer, Marcy Holland, who wrote the "Time For 'X' to Come Home For Christmas" movies. If they gave out Emmy Awards for best Christmas movie screenplays, she'd win for this one. John Putch, who directed last year's excellent "A Holiday Spectacular", which was also set in the past, beautifully recreated the past in this movie too. And it was a Christmas movie in the sense that "Die Hard" is a Christmas movie; it takes place during Christmas and there are lots of holiday decorations. The essence of the story, however, was the chemistry between John and Lucy and the theme of taking a risk for someone else. I just loved this gem of a movie.
The Biltmore may be the drawing card for this movie, but it's Bethany Joy Lenz, Kristoffer Polaha, the script, and the entire production that are the aces. Lenz is always very good, but here she is outstanding as Lucy, as is Kristoffer Polaha as Jack Huston. Plus, the chemistry they have on screen is quite remarkable, maybe because their characters are so endearing. Yes, this is a fantasy involving intrigue and time travel, but it so convincingly written that it becomes almost realistic and believable because of the dialogue, the locations, and the performances. The intermittent use of black and white camerawork is a brilliant idea and serves to enhance the story and the characters of Jack, Ava, and Claude, the three movie stars in 1946's fictional movie "His Merry Wife !". Colton Little and particularly newcomer Annabelle Borke are wonderful as Ava and Claude. Everything here is perfect : the direction by John Putch, the writing by Marcy Holland, the music by Tommy Fields (which has already been nominated for an award), the production design, the art and set direction, the costumes, and the cinematography. Mention must be made of Tracy Kilpatrick who had the insight to put this cast together. And don't think that the character of Margaret is too bizarre. Here, in Michigan, we have Mackinac Island where "Somewhere In Time" was filmed. The fans of that film flock to the island and many are just as zany as Margaret, played nicely here by A. K. Benninghofen. This film is so interesting and of such exceptional quality that I would have paid to see it at the show - it far exceeds some to the movies that are released in theaters nowadays. Even better than "Somewhere In Time," too.
